Magnesium metaborate

Antifungin EINECS 237-235-5 Magnesium borate Magnesium metaborate. An antiseptic and fungicide. Occurs in a variety of minerals. White powder, slightly soluble in H2O. [Pg.374]

Natrosol is soluble in most 10% salt solutions, excluding sodium carbonate and sodium sulfate, and many 50% salt solutions with the exception of the following aluminum sulfate ammonium sulfate diammonium phosphate disodium phosphate ferric chloride magnesium sulfate potassium ferrocyanide sodium metaborate sodium nitrate sodium sulfite trisodium phosphate and zinc sulfate. Natrosol 150 is generally more tolerant of dissolved salts than is Natrosol 250. [Pg.332]

The first step, the formation of sodium metaborate from borax and sodium hydroxide, is carried out at temperatures up to 90°C. When impure borax is used the solution is filtered. The second step is carried out at 25 °C and the mixture subsequently cooled to 15°C and the precipitated sodium peroxoborate hexahydrate filtered off. Stabilizers for the perborate, such as silicates or magnesium salts, may be added to the reaction mixture. Residual moisture (3 to 10%) is removed in a hot air drier. The mother liquor from the second step can be returned to the first step. [Pg.25]

Borax is dissolved in sodium hydroxide solution to make sodium metaborate (NaB02) solution. When the native mineral is used, this step is followed by decantation or filtration. The NaB02 solution is then mixed with H2O2 in a cooled reactor under carefully controlled conditions to produce attrition-resistant crystals. This leads to the crystallization of PBS4. Stabilizers are added either before or after the crystallization stage to improve storage and in-pack stability. Possible stabilizers include magnesium sulfate and alkali or alkaline earth metal silicate [18]. [Pg.427]

Other advanced methods for the manufacture of NaBH4 have been investigated by Toyota Motor Co and academic researchers in Japan. Most notable is the use of magnesium hydride for direct reduction of boron oxide feedstocks, including anhydrous borax, for initial synthesis of NaBlfj (Equation 16.15) and reduction of anhydrous sodium metaborate for regeneration of spent borohy-dride (Equation 16.16) [38], Aluminum metal has also been used instead of magnesium and catalysts employed to improve kinetics. [Pg.393]
